Requirements

  • 3–5 years of dedicated hands-on experience in cloud security, DevSecOps, or infrastructure security engineering.
  • Deep working knowledge of core AWS security services including IAM, GuardDuty, Security Hub, KMS, CloudTrail, and Organizations.
  • Strong proficiency in Infrastructure as Code, with Terraform preferred.
  • At least one scripting language proficiency in Python, Go, or Bash.
  • Practical experience securing Kubernetes/EKS and configuring CI/CD security scanners such as GitHub Actions or GitLab CI.
  • Solid understanding of cloud networking including VPCs, Transit Gateways, WAF, and DNS.
  • Understanding of identity management including OAuth2, OIDC, and SAML.
  • Familiarity with mapping cloud controls to industry frameworks such as CIS Benchmarks, NIST CSF, and SOC 2.
  • Preferred certifications: AWS Certified Security – Specialty, Certified Kubernetes Security Specialist (CKS), or CCSP.
  • Prior experience in travel, experiences, or marketplace businesses is a plus.

Responsibilities

  • Design, deploy, and enforce scalable cloud security controls, IAM least-privilege policies, and encryption standards across multi-account AWS environments.
  • Embed automated security tools like IaC scanning, SAST, and secret detection into CI/CD pipelines to catch vulnerabilities pre-deployment.
  • Develop automated detection and remediation workflows using Python, Bash, or Go alongside IaC tools like Terraform and CloudFormation.
  • Implement and maintain security practices for containerized workloads using Docker and Kubernetes/EKS, as well as serverless architectures.
  • Manage CSPM/CNAPP platforms, investigate high-priority alerts, and reduce noise through automated risk scoring and alert tuning.
  • Conduct architectural security reviews and threat modeling for new cloud features, infrastructure changes, and third-party integrations.
  • Act as a secondary point of contact for cloud security incidents, assisting with forensic collection, root-cause analysis, and post-mortem actions.
